??Ubuntu16设置Redis开机自启动设置条件:-Ubuntu16.04-Redis-4.0.11在redis目录下找到 utils/redis_init_script 复制到/etc/init.d/redis 打开文件进行修改步骤:(主要Linux命令)whereis redis # 查找redis目录...
Ubuntu16设置Redis开机自启动
设置条件:
-Ubuntu16.04
-Redis-4.0.11
在redis目录下找到 utils/redis_init_script
复制到/etc/init.d/redis
打开文件进行修改
步骤:(主要Linux命令)
whereis redis # 查找redis目录
sudo cp redis_init_script /etc/init.d/redis # 复制文件
cd /etc/init.d/ # 进入文件目录 sudo vim redis # 编辑配置文件redis
原配置文件
#!/bin/sh # # Simple Redis init.d script conceived to work on Linux systems # as it does use of the /proc filesystem. ? ### BEGIN INIT INFO # Provides: redis_6379 # Default-Start: 2 3 4 5 # Default-Stop: 0 1 6 # Short-Description: Redis data structure server # Description: Redis data structure server. See https://redis.io ### END INIT INFO ? REDISPORT=6379 EXEC=/usr/local/bin/redis-server CLIEXEC=/usr/local/bin/redis-cli ? PIDFILE=/var/run/redis_${REDISPORT}.pid CONF="/etc/redis/${REDISPORT}.conf"
修改后的配置文件
#!/bin/sh # # chkconfig: 2345 90 10 ---这里修改 # description: Redis is a persistent key-value database ---这里修改 ? ### BEGIN INIT INFO # Provides: redis_6379 # Required-Start: ---这里修改 # Required-Stop: ---这里修改 # Default-Start: 2 3 4 5 # Default-Stop: 0 1 6 # Short-Description: Redis data structure server # Description: Redis data structure server. See https://redis.io ### END INIT INFO ? REDISPORT=6379 EXEC=/usr/local/bin/redis-server CLIEXEC=/usr/local/bin/redis-cli ? PIDFILE=/var/run/redis_${REDISPORT}.pid CONF="/etc/redis/redis.conf" ---这里修改
修改完配置文件后执行下面两条命令
sudo chmod +x /etc/init.d/redis # 取得权限
sudo update-rc.d redis defaults # 加载到系统自启动文件
测试命令:
kady@ubuntu:/etc/init.d$ sudo update-rc.d redis defaults kady@ubuntu:/etc/init.d$ service redis start # 启动redis服务 kady@ubuntu:/etc/init.d$ redis-cli 127.0.0.1:6379> # 设置成功
其他命令:
? ? ? ?启动服务: service redis start
停止服务: service redis stop
重启服务: service redis restart
本文标题为:Ubuntu16设置Redis开机自启动
基础教程推荐
- 【Redis】数据持久化 2023-09-12
- SQLServer 清理日志的实现 2023-07-29
- python中pandas库的iloc函数用法解析 2023-07-28
- Redis如何实现延迟队列 2023-07-13
- 如何将excel表格数据导入postgresql数据库 2023-07-20
- Mysql查询所有表和字段信息的方法 2023-07-26
- 关于MySQL中explain工具的使用 2023-07-27
- Sql Server Management Studio连接Mysql的实现步骤 2023-07-29
- Python常见库matplotlib学习笔记之多个子图绘图 2023-07-27
- Mysql主从三种复制模式(异步复制,半同步复制,组复 2022-09-01